Do not reach into the tubes
The excessive crushing, stretching and bending of power lines has to be avoided.
The power line system has to be checked for abrasion points regularly.
Mounting or the electrical connection of the power line system must be carried out by a qualified electrician.
Do not damage seals during installation as otherwise the technical characteristics cannot be complied with.
When using panel coupling components, always ensure that the stability of the mounting surface is suitable
for mounting.
The coupling components are designed for mounting centrally on the control enclosure.
Off-center installation is not permitted.
The tightening torques of the screw connections should be inspected on a regular basis.

Earthing example
As it is a suspension system with moving parts, it should be ensured that the chosen cable
length permits these movements.
Cable crimp
Earthing conductor
Earthing conductor
Earthing
continuity screw
Serrated contact washer
The included screw can only be used for a crimp type socket.
Screw length (L) must be suitable for the amount of crimps being used!!
A serrated washer must separate each cable crimp!
